Artykuł omawia problem bezpieczeństwa danych w lokalnym oprogramowaniu pierwszego typu (local-first software) oraz możliwość użycia CRDTs (Completely Replicated Data Types) razem z szyfrowaniem homomorficznym.
Szyfrowanie homomorficzne pozwala na wykonywanie operacji na zaszyfrowanych danych bez konieczności ich odszyfrowania, co zwiększa prywatność użytkowników.
Szyfrowanie homomorficzne ma swoje ograniczenia, takie jak duże rozmiary kluczy i wolniejsze działanie, co może być uciążliwe dla aplikacji lokalnych.
Artykuł opisuje również implementację homomorficznie szyfrowanego CRDT typu "last write wins register", ilustrując problemy związane z tym podejściem.
Mimo iż szyfrowanie homomorficzne oferuje ciekawe możliwości, zawiera także fundamentalne ograniczenia, które mogą ograniczać jego użyteczność w kontekście lokalnego oprogramowania.
Get notified when new stories are published for "🇵🇱 Hacker News Polski"